Safety from Domestic Violence and Abuse
Supports women and their children affected by domestic abuse. Offers safe housing and free support before, during, and after leaving an abusive situation. Help is available whether or not you choose to leave, and for issues like immigration, disability, discrimination, debt, addiction, or NRPF.

Coventry Women’s Aid offers specialist support for women affected by domestic abuse, sexual abuse, forced marriage, and female genital mutilation. Services include emotional support, refuge accommodation, risk and safety planning, and help navigating legal, health, and safeguarding systems. All support is free, confidential, and tailored to each woman’s needs.

Training

Call before attending
Coventry Haven Women’s Aid offers comprehensive training and awareness programs for professionals and community members to deepen understanding of domestic abuse, including topics like forced marriage, honour-based abuse, and female genital mutilation (FGM). Their sessions cover recognizing signs of abuse, understanding its impact, and providing safe, sensitive support. They also offer age-appropriate education for children and young people.

Additionally, the 'One Step Forward' course is a free, six-week online program designed for survivors, providing a safe space to explore the effects of abuse and pathways to recovery.
